                    In my opinion that should have been a safe pass. There was plenty of room for three wide and TR on the left acted responsibly. The gal had overlap on the car to the right before they reached the TR. So there was no reason for the car on the right to move left and cause the incident.

                    Blame to the car on the left.

                          An SRF racer on another list that I'm on said that the rear visibility is so bad on an SRF that the guy on the right likely never saw her. His solution would have been to tap the guy on the right lightly before the gap closed to let him know he was there. Huh!?! I guess those SCCA guys take that "Rubbin' is Racin'" stuff to heart!

                          That said, she should have realized that she was creating a 4-wide scenario that was going to be risky.
